> The Problem is, that there is no folder at
> "D:/Development/wireshark-win64-libs". Last time I started CMake for win7
> compilation the folder and its content was automatically be downloaded, but
> right now I don't know how to get the folder with its content by myself.
>
> At which part will it be downloaded? Maybe there Is a failure at this
> point?
>

It's supposed to be downloaded while generating CMake files through
PowerShell (it is running the tools/win-setup.ps1 script). Just gave it a
try and it works fine for me.

Here is the corresponding code in CMakeLists.txt

    # Download third-party libraries
    file (TO_NATIVE_PATH ${CMAKE_SOURCE_DIR}/tools/win-setup.ps1 _win_setup)
    file (TO_NATIVE_PATH ${_PROJECT_LIB_DIR} _ws_lib_dir)
    if(MSVC14)
        set(_vsversion_args "14")
    elseif(MSVC12)
        set(_vsversion_args "12")
    elseif(MSVC11)
        set(_vsversion_args "11")
    elseif(MSVC10)
        set(_vsversion_args "10")
    else()
        message(FATAL_ERROR "Unsupported compiler ${CMAKE_C_COMPILER}")
    endif()

    # Is it possible to have a one-time, non-cached option in CMake? If
    # so, we could add a "-DFORCE_WIN_SETUP" which passes -Force to
    # win-setup.ps1.
    execute_process(
        COMMAND ${POWERSHELL_COMMAND} "\"${_win_setup}\"" -Destination
"${_ws_lib_dir}" -Platform ${WIRESHARK_TARGET_PLATFORM} -VSVersion
${_vsversion_args}
        RESULT_VARIABLE _win_setup_failed
    )
    if (${_win_setup_failed})
        message(FATAL_ERROR "Windows setup (win-setup.ps1) failed.")
    endif()

    # XXX Add a dependency on ${_ws_lib_dir}/current_tag.txt?
